Does Active Transport Need Energy. To move substances against a concentration or electrochemical gradient, the cell must use energy. Active transport needs energy either directly as atp or that generated from the electrochemical gradient to transport substances from their. This energy comes from atp generated through the cell’s metabolism. Active transport uses energy stored in atp to fuel this transport. Why does active transport require energy? The key difference between active and passive transport is that active transport requires energy, while passive transport does not. Active transport mechanisms require the use of the cell’s energy, usually in the form of adenosine triphosphate (atp). Active and passive transport are two. Active transport uses energy to move substances across cell membranes, while passive transport does not require energy.
